## Meet `pixsquish`

Welcome aboard. `pixsquish` is the Tallowmere CLI we use for batch image resizing across the asset pipeline. It chews through upload queues nightly, and when it stalls, the on-call gets paged — usually it's a corrupt source file wedging the worker. Don't panic: kill the stuck job, requeue, and move on. Flags, retry behavior, and the list of known cursed file types are all documented on the internal page here:

runbook for badug-kadup: https://confluence.zemvarlabs.internal/projects/browse/display/projects/bd1b

Plugins submit jobs to the Framelode transcoding farm through the `/v1/transcode` endpoint. Each job specifies an input locator, a target profile, and an optional priority hint; the farm validates profiles before queuing. Sandbox submissions are capped at ten concurrent jobs. Authenticate sandbox requests with the plugin sandbox key below.

API key for yagef-bagef: zpat23_RTEspBOEmE9eDRK8oFjwnRE

Lost-badge procedure for contractors at Pellam Court: report the loss to the security lodge immediately so the badge can be deactivated. A replacement is issued the same day once your sponsor confirms your booking. While you wait, use the visitor gate beside reception; the temporary gate code is provided below.

turnstile pass: bdg-QZV-3